I just fixed a relcache leak that I accidentally introduced (5a1d0c9925). Because it was a TAP test involving replication workers, you don't see the usual warning anywhere unless you specifically check the log files manually.

How about a compile-time option to turn all the warnings in resowner.c into errors? This could be enabled automatically by --enable-cassert, similar to other defines that that option enables.

--
Peter Eisentraut              http://www.2ndQuadrant.com/
PostgreSQL Development, 24x7 Support, Remote DBA, Training & Services


Reply via email to